Selected MERO engagements

Triskelle
Education
Statewide platform engineering
Technical leadership and development for a statewide IEP/IFSP platform using .NET and Angular. Integrated student-information systems, operated Azure environments, and tuned application code and a 1.2 TB Azure SQL database.
Snap-on Tools
Automotive & ecommerce
Application development & Azure migration
Built General Motors’ Tool Initiation application with .NET 10 and React, developed two dealership ecommerce applications, and migrated 18+ automotive ecommerce applications to Azure App Service and Azure SQL.
TSP
Systems integration
Data & event services
Built services to transfer and transform data between external and client applications using Node.js, TypeScript, PostgreSQL, Docker, and Terraform, with production delivery across AWS and Azure.
PaySafe
Financial services
Microservices & customer service
Designed C#/.NET microservices and SQL Server schemas, and developed an Angular customer-service application secured with Okta.
